1. Sumosan Twiga

What is it? Sumosan Twiga, in Knightsbridge, is special. It's a place that brings together yummy Italian and Japanese food. It’s more than a restaurant—it’s a spot where friends or couples can enjoy a fancy evening with good food, drinks, and music.

Why we love it: We love Sumosan Twiga because it's not just eating; it's an adventure. The menu boasts award-winning dishes that are sure to impress. Enjoy amazing drinks, dance to great music, and you might even spot a celebrity. It's the perfect mix of fantastic food and fun, making Sumosan Twiga a top choice for luxury dining in London.

Sunday,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day, Friday, Saturday

165 Sloane Street, SW1X 9QB London

8. Park Chinois

What is it? Step into the glam of Park Chinois in Mayfair, where the 1930s Shanghai charm blends with today's luxury. This place isn't just for eating; it's a whole fancy experience shaped by Jacques Garcia. With Executive Chef Lee Che Liang leading, every dish takes you on a trip through real Chinese tastes, using the freshest of the season.

Why we love it: At Park Chinois, it's all about the feeling. The live music, the chatter, and the stylish decor take you back in time, making every visit stand out. It's perfect for a date night or a fun evening with friends. Here, meals are more than tasty; they're moments you won't forget.

Sunday,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day, Friday, Saturday

17 Berkeley Street, W1J 8EA London

9. Nobu

What is it? In the heart of Mayfair, you'll find Nobu London at 19 Old Park Lane. It's a place where Japanese food gets a modern twist. This spot is all about luxury and a peaceful vibe, making it the perfect place for top-notch dining.

Why we love it: It's more than just eating; it's an experience. The black cod miso is a must-try, and the yellowtail sashimi and sushi rolls are all about amazing tastes. They have a fantastic sake selection that sake lovers will adore. The staff knows how to pick the perfect drink for your meal, making every visit special. Nobu London is ideal for a romantic night out or a big celebration, offering incredible Japanese cuisine with a modern touch in an elegantly quiet setting.

Sunday,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day, Friday, Saturday

19 Old Park Lane, W1K 1LB London

10. Hakkasan

What is it? Step into Hakkasan London, where tradition meets today in Mayfair. With two Michelin stars, this place shines in Cantonese food artistry. Enjoy top dishes, amazing drinks, and breathtaking design that spells luxury at every turn.

Why we love it: It’s more than just food; it’s a journey. Every bite and every sip reveals new delights, from rich flavors in the food to special wines and champagnes. The cool atmosphere is perfect for a night of treats, and you can even taste the magic at home with Hakkasan at Home. Mixing old and new, it’s a tribute to Cantonese cuisine you’ll fall for again and again.

Sunday,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day, Friday, Saturday

17 Bruton Street, W1J 6QB London
